Troubleshooting
Circuit Board Diagnostics
Diagnostics for the IVP4/6 boards can be run to determine whether everything is
connected properly and that there is a dial tone. To run the IVP4/6 board
diagnostics on all installed boards, follow these steps:
1. Log in to the system and proceed to the Configuration Management
window. (See Chapter 5, System Operations if you need instructions.)
2. Move the cursor to System Control and press
— The System Control window is displayed.
3. Move the cursor to Diagnose Equipment and press
— The Diagnose Equipment window is displayed.
4. Fill in the fields as follows:
— Equipment: ca for "card"
— Equipment Number: all
— Diagnose Immediately? yes
5. Press y to continue.
6. Press
The diagnosis takes more than 60 seconds. A working icon appears in
the right hand corner of the screen.
The system searches for dial tones (Loop Current) on the boards and then
informs you if each IVP4/6 board passes the test. If any IVP4/6 board
fails, check to see if it is seated properly. If that does not fix the problem,
you will have to replace the board. If dial tones are not found, check the
Tip/Ring connections.
7. Press
displayed.
8. Select Exit to return to the log on prompt.
Fax Board Diagnostics
Fax board diagnostics provide a way to determine whether or not the fax boards
installed in the system are working properly. These diagnostic capabilities are
available on a per-channel and a per-board basis. That is, you can select which
specific resource to diagnose. The diagnostic tests performed are:
check dma transfers
check interrupts
check onboard RAM
